My blood is boiling. 

"Did you know these were here?" I glare at Theo. 

"Shh!" He whispers. "Y-yes, I knew there was wanted posters around, but I didn't think it was a big deal. I wasn't even sure it was you, it doesn't even look like you."

That last part is partially true; all my features are a bit exaggerated in the artist's rendition. But no one else in Valon looks remotely like this. Making a connection between me and this photo would be like picking out an orange from a bunch of apples. So I don't buy it. 

My voice is cold when I speak. "Are you trying to get me captured, Theo?"

His eyes widen, and he looks genuinely hurt. "No! Of course not. You're the one who convinced me to bring you out here, you gave me your plan for a disguise and everything. I thought it would be okay. I took your word for it."

"My face with the words 'Dead or Alive' is literally plastered around town and you couldn't think to tell me about it!? I probably would've reconsidered you know!"

"What were you expecting!?" He shoots back. "Didn't you say you were a fugitive or something? Of course there's going to be people looking for you and spreading the word about you!" He's getting defensive, and the frustration seeps through his face. "And-and like...you don't make any sense! What were you planning to do anyway??? Just stay in the tree house forever!?"

The boy is right. I should've seen this coming. Actually, I think somewhere in my subconscious I knew that I had no idea what my next step should be. It used to be all I thought about, but I couldn't find the answer. I thought of suicide, a lot. I thought of moving out of Valon, to another town like Eseq, but that would be so hard to pull off, so I put the thought aside. When Theo gave me the tree house I decided to ignore and put everything aside, at least until I was healed. I tried to get comfortable and treat the boy like a friend. I tried to distract myself from everything. I boxed myself out of reality. 

But seeing this wanted poster was a slap in the face. Everything immediately felt more real. I am the Blood King's prisoner, I escaped from his cage. The Blood King, who was rumored to torture hostages just for fun. Who tortured me just for fun. A man who was said to take the blood of his victims and keep them for himself, as a prize. A man who had no remorse as he reopened my wound and dragged me on the floor while I was weak and helpless in prison. 

I read the poster over and over again. His Majesty the King offers the highest reward. 

Before I know it I've fallen to my knees, and I start to shake. I've curled up into a little ball, rocking back and forth. Theo tries to get me to stand. "Lady get up!! Lady!!" He's whispering in a panic, trying to be discreet. "We're going to catch attention. We need to leave before anyone sees us." 

But I can't bring myself to stand. All I can think about is, He's going to catch me. He's going to hurt me again. He might kill me. What do I do? What should I do? He's going to kill me. 

I kind of want him to kill me. 

An anxious Theo tries to hoist me up, but I swat him away. "Go!" I shout through tears. I didn't even notice I was crying. "Just go. Just let me die here. Let me die!" Let the inevitable happen. 

Alarmed, he tries to calm me down. "Don't...just don't do this now, okay? You're the adult here, aren't you? R-right? You need to, um....be strong and all that. People are going to notice you. I don't want you to die. I really...I care about you, okay? P-please."

At his last sentence I look up. The boy's eyes are pleading, he looks scared out of his mind. I'm probably putting him in danger too. He's absolutely right. But at the same time, a part of me doesn't care. He doesn't know what I've done and what I've been through. I'm willing to bet he's never seen the Blood King in person. He's never faced terror like this before. He doesn't know--

"Sir, are you alright?"

The two of us freeze, fix the scarves around our faces and turn behind us. It's a townsman, looking concerned. "I heard someone yell--I thought it was a woman, but I suppose I was hearing things, is everything okay?"

I face the other way, so he can't catch a glimpse of me. Theo attempts to cover. "Actually, sir, everything is fine, we just--"

Then another voice speaks up. "What the hell is going on down there?"

Someone else says, "What's all this commotion about?"

Then another. "It's the middle of the day, goddamnit! Who in the world is causing this ruckus?!"

Seemingly a second later we've been surrounded by a crowd. People are circling us, poking me on the back, wondering why I won't face them. Theo throws his hands up to protect me, and he gets pushed around. Some people call him a pipsqueak, a brat, and they threaten to call authorities on us if we don't move and face them. 

Something inside me snaps, and I have the energy to move again. I cover my face the best I can, grab Theo, and try to find an opening through the crowd. I see a skinny, scrawny man to the left of me and I try to run past him, but he turns out to be stronger than he looks: he shoves me down, and part of my cloak rips, revealing the bandages I wrapped around my chest. 

Theo's eyes are terrified. "Lady!" He calls out to me in a panic, and I weakly sit up from the ground while the boy throws himself in front of me, covering me up. 

"Did that kid call him Lady?"

"Look at the older one!"

"That's the waist of a woman alright."

"Look at her skin!"

"Someone get a King's soldier down here!"

They zero in on us. I hug Theo with all my might. Our heartbeats are both beating faster than ever before. I need to get up and run. That's our only option. But they're going to trap us. 

My mind is racing with different thoughts and emotions at once. If I don't get out of this, I hope Theo is okay. He's trembling in my arms, he's scared, he's--

The boy takes my hands off of him, looking me in the eye. His expression has changed. Just a moment ago, he was petrified, but now his green eyes are sharp, steady, focused. He pats my hand reassuringly, and gets up, facing the crowd of people. What in the world is he doing?

Theo grabs the scarf covering his face and rips it off, tossing it to the side, revealing his entire face. My eyes widen. Why is he giving away his identity? My heart beats faster. 

But the crowd has a different reaction. Gasps befall the crowd. Everyone takes a few steps back. Some jaws drop. Some people run back into their homes, others fall to their hands and knees before the boy. 

I look around in confusion. "Theo!" I whisper. "What are you doing?!" 

Then I see a horse with a rider approach us. It's a soldier dressed in armor. I tighten the cloth around my face and readjust my cloak to cover my body. 

"What's all this commotion? You're all disturbing the--" The moment the soldier makes eye contact with the boy in front of me he freezes. He then drops down from the horse he's on and bows, flustered. "Y-your Highness, what are you doing in town, so far away from the palace--"

"That is none of your concern," Theo says, his voice booming. "Bring me a carriage, big enough for two. Return me to my chamber at once." 

The boy turns, takes my hand and helps me get up. "My companion and I had business here," he says, addressing not only the soldier but the crowd around us as well. "Frankly it's quite troubling--maybe even treasonous."

Immediately the townsfolk around us begin to cry out, begging on their knees for forgiveness. 

"Silence!" They quiet down in a nanosecond. "Consider yourselves lucky for today. I have no time to deal with insolence."

They make a pathway for us, and Theo and I walk hand in hand towards the soldier, who helps us both climb the horse. 

"But do be warned," Theo says in his emboldened voice. "If I ever hear of this incident, or if anyone tries to bring my companion and I trouble, the consequences won't be given lightly."

He smirks at the gaping crowd, sending a chill down my spine. "I know for sure my brother-in-law won't hesitate to take action."

Brother-in-law?

My heart stops. It can't be...

He motions to the soldier to take us out of the area, but not before he looks back at the crowd. "Keep your mouths shut, and go about your lives as if you had never seen us." He puts his scarf back on, preparing to move out. 

"That is an order from me, First Prince Teio, of the Teron Kingdom."
